﻿body, div, dl, dt, dd, ul, ol, li, h1, h2, h3, h4, h5,h6, pre, form, fieldset, input, p, blockquote, table, th, td, embed,object {
     padding: 0;
     margin: 0; 
}
table {
     border-collapse: collapse;
     border-spacing: 0;
}
address, caption, cite, code, dfn, em, 
h1, h2, h3, h4, h5, h6, strong, th, var {
     font-weight: normal;
     font-style: normal;
}
ul {
     list-style: none;
}
a img, :link img, :visited img {
        border:0px;
}
body { font-size:12px; font-family:Verdana, Geneva, sans-serif; background:url(../images/bg.jpg);}

.clear { clear:both;}
.layout { width:1011px; margin:0 auto;}
.header { height:74px; width:1011px; background:url(../images/header-bg.jpg) no-repeat; margin:0 auto; color:#FFF;}
.logo { width:248px; height:73px; float:left;}
.header-right { width:763px; float:right;}
.column1 { text-align:right; height:25px; line-height:25px; padding-right:8px;}
.column1 a{color:#ffffff; text-decoration:none}
/*导航*/
.navSel{ background:url(../images/nav-bg.gif) no-repeat;}

.nav { margin-top:16px; height:33px; line-height:33px; padding-left:25px;}
.nav ul li { float:left; padding:0 5px; text-align:center; position:relative;}
.nav ul li a { color:#FFF; text-decoration:none; font-size:14px; font-weight:bolder; width:85px; height:33px; display:block;}
.nav ul li .a1:hover { background:url(../images/nav-bg.gif) no-repeat;}
.nav ul li ul {
	display:none;	
	position:absolute;
	width:610px;
	left: -122px;
}
.nav ul li .subnav4 {
	display:none;
	position:absolute;
	 width:700px;
	left:-382px;
}
.nav ul li .subnav5 {
	display:none;
	position:absolute;
	 width:450px;
	left: -50px;
}

.nav ul li .subnav5L {
	display:none;
	position:absolute;
	 width:450px;
	left: -180px;
}

.nav ul li ul li { float:left; height:27px;}
.nav ul li ul li a {font-size:12px; width:72px;font-weight:normal; color:#333; height:29px; line-height:29px; padding-left:5px;background:url(../images/arrow0.gif) no-repeat 2px 12px ;  }
.nav ul li ul { width:660px;}
.nav ul li ul li a:hover { color:#1f449c;background:url(../images/nav2-arrow2.gif) no-repeat -4px 0 ;height:37px;}

/*圆角与子导航背景*/
.top-right { background:url(../images/yuanjiao2.gif) no-repeat right; height:27px;}
.top-left{ background:url(../images/yuanjiao1.gif) no-repeat; height:27px;}
.top { width:976px; margin-left:17px; height:27px; background:#FFF;}


.main { width:auto; background:#FFF;}
.main1 { width:976px; margin:0 auto;}
.main2 { padding-top:20px;}

/*布局左边*/
.main-left { width:221px; float:left;}
.left1 {padding-top:1px; padding-left:1px;border:#d9d9d9 solid 2px; padding-bottom:15px;}

/*导航2*/
.nav2 ul { padding-top:10px; width:204px; margin: 0 auto; }
.nav2 ul li { width:204px; height:25px; background:url(../images/nav2-bg.gif) no-repeat; padding-left:8px; line-height:25px;}
.nav2 ul li a { color:#000; text-decoration:none; background:url(../images/arrow1.jpg) no-repeat -2px;  display:block; padding-left:15px;}
.nav2 ul li a:hover { color:#1f449c; text-decoration:none; background:url(../images/arrow2.gif) no-repeat -2px;}

.build { padding-top:10px;}
.build img { border:#cce8fe solid 1px;}

/*New 项目*/
.newitemo{ width:221px; height:124px; background:url(../images/new-itemo.jpg) no-repeat; margin-top:5px; }
.newitemo ul { width:207px; margin: 0 auto;padding-top:22px;}
.newitemo ul li { width:69px; float:left;}
.newitemo ul li span { display:block; line-height:25px;; height:25px;}
.newitemo ul li a {color:#333; text-decoration:none;}
.newitemo ul li a:hover {color:#1f449c; text-decoration:none;}
.newitemo ul li span img { vertical-align: middle;margin:5px 0;}

/*服务团队*/
.serviceteam { width:221px; height:337px; background:url(../images/service-team.jpg) no-repeat; margin-top:5px; }
.serviceteam ul {padding-top:40px;margin:0 auto;width:180px;} 
.serviceteam ul li { height:74px;padding-bottom:10px; padding-top:10px; _padding-bottom:0; text-align:left}
.serviceteam ul li img { float:left; border:#9fb3c8 solid 1px;}
.serviceteam ul li .tx1 { padding-left:10px; display:block; float:right; width:100px; line-height:150%;} 
.serviceteam ul li .tx1 h3 { color:#cc0000; font-weight:bolder; font-size:13px;}
.serviceteam ul .line1 { border-bottom:#5587b2 dotted 1px;}
.serviceteam a{color:#000; }
.serviceteam a:hover{color:#999; }

/*服务优势*/
.goodservice { width:221px; height:333px; background:url(../images/good-service.jpg) no-repeat; margin-top:5px;}
.goodservice ul { padding-top:40px; width:190px; margin:0 auto;}
.goodservice ul li { height:38px; padding-bottom:6px; padding-top:6px;}
.goodservice ul li img { float:left; border:#CCC solid 1px;}
.goodservice ul .line2 {border-bottom:#ccc dotted 1px;}
.goodservice ul li .tx2 { float:right; width:140px; display:block; line-height:140%;}
.goodservice ul li .tx2 h3 { color:#F00; font-size:13px;}
.button1 { padding-left:7px;}

/*布局右边*/
.main-right { width:744px; float:right; overflow:hidden; padding-right:2px;}
.right1 { width:741px; border-bottom:#c6e0f9 solid 1px; border-left:#c6e0f9 solid 1px; border-right:#c6e0f9 solid 1px; min-height:180px; height:auto !important; height:180px; margin-bottom:8px; }
.newsbg { float:left; width:290px; height:34px; background:url(../images/News.gif) no-repeat;}
.processbg { float:right; width:454px; height:34px; background:url(../images/process.gif) no-repeat; color:#b51e20; text-align:right; line-height:34px;}

/*新闻动态*/
.news { width:290px; float:left;padding-top:10px;}
.news ul { list-style:url(../images/arrow3.gif); padding-left:40px; }
.news ul span { color:#888; font-size:11px;}
.news ul li a { color:#333; text-decoration:none; line-height:27px; font-size:13px; line-height:27px;}
.news ul li a:hover { color:#009a44; text-decoration:none;}

/*合作流程*/
.process { width:451px; float:right;padding-top:20px;}
.process img { padding-left:25px;}
.process ul { width:430px; margin:0 auto; padding-top:15px;}
.process ul li { float:left; height:25px; line-height:25px; padding: 0 5px; display:block; overflow:hidden}

.banner2 { margin-bottom:5px;}



/*网站套餐建设*/
.menu-build { width:744px;min-height:270px; height:auto !important; height:270px;}
.menu-build2 {width:741px;padding-bottom:5px; border:#b3defd solid 1px; min-height:230px; height:auto !important; height:230px;}
.menu-build2 ul { padding-left:5px; padding-top:3px;}
.menu-build2 ul .new1 { width:219px; height:102px; background:url(../images/menu-bg1.jpg) no-repeat; color:#000; font-weight:bolder; }
.menu-build2 ul li {width:219px; height:102px; background:url(../images/menu-bg2.jpg) no-repeat; float:left; margin:2px 6px; padding-top:7px; padding-left:10px;}
.menu-build2 ul .new1 .s1,.menu-build2 ul li .s1 { color:#036fb8; font-weight:bolder;}
.menu-build2 ul .new1 .s2,.menu-build2 ul li .s2 { color: #F00; font-weight:bolder;}
.menu-build2 ul .new1 .s3,.menu-build2 ul li .s3 { color: #333; font-weight:normal; width:200px; display:block; margin-top:15px; height:65px;}
.menu-build2 ul .new1 .s3 img,.menu-build2 ul li .s3 img { float:left; padding-right:5px;}
.menu-build2 ul .new1 .s3 span,.menu-build2 ul li .s3 span { color:#43af03;}


/*作品赏析*/
.work { width:744px; margin-top:5px;}
.work-bg { width:742px; min-height:200px; height:auto !important; height:200px; border-left:#daedf7 solid 1px; border-right:#daedf7 solid 1px;}
.work-bg ul { padding-top:15px;}
.work-bg ul li { width:156px; float:left; padding-left:17px; display:inline; }
.work-bg ul li span { display:block; text-align:center;height:35px;}
.work-bg ul li a { color: #000; text-decoration:none; line-height:35px; height:35px;}
.work-bg ul li a:hover { color:#0a3bb0; text-decoration:none;}
.work-bg ul li .imglink { border:#eeeeee solid 3px; width:156px; height:100px; display:block;}
.work-bg ul li .imglink:hover { border:#97dbf3 solid 3px;}
.work-show{background:url(../images/work-show.jpg); height:70px;}
.work-show span{ float:right;padding:22px;}

.title2-right { float:right;}

/*凡迅科技*/
.fxkj { width:377px; float:left;}
.fxkj h6 { background:url(../images/fxkj.gif); }

.fxkj-main { border:#b2d6f8 solid 1px; height:146px; padding:7px 0 5px 5px;}
.fxkj-main span { float:right; width:225px; padding-right:5px; padding-top:5px; color:#5c5c5c;}
.banner4 { margin-top:5px;}
.fxkj h6,.customer h6 { height:20px; padding-top:18px; padding-left:30px; font-size:14px; font-weight:bold; color:#fff;}
.fxkj h6 span,.customer h6 span { float:right; padding-right:5px;}

/*客户评价*/
.customer { width:362px; float:right;}
.customer h6 { background:url(../images/customer.gif);}
.customer-main {  border:#b2d6f8 solid 1px; height:158px;}
.customer ul { padding:5px;}
.customer li { height:64px; padding:5px;}
.tit { display:block; float:left; width:96px; height:58px; overflow:hidden;}
.customer li span { float:left; width:230px; padding:2px 0 0 10px; color:#ec9e06; font-weight:bolder; display:block;}
.customer li span a { color:#c00; text-decoration:none;}
.customer li p { float:left; width:230px; padding:5px 0 0 10px;}

/*知名客户*/
.friend { width:974px; padding-top:2px; margin-top:10px; border:#d1e4f5 solid 1px; padding-left:2px; }
.friend-bg { background:url(../images/friend-bg.gif) repeat-x; width:845px; float:right; height:30px; margin-right:1px; display:inline;}
.friend ul { width:920px; margin:0 auto; padding:10px 0;}
.friend ul li { float:left; padding:10px 6px;}

/*底部圆角*/
.bottom-right { width: auto; height:16px; background:url(../images/yuanjiao4.gif) no-repeat right;}
.bottom-left { width:auto; height:16px; background:url(../images/yuanjiao3.gif) no-repeat;}
.bottom-center { margin-left:20px; width:976px; background:#FFF; height:16px;}

.footer { padding-top:10px; padding-bottom:20px;color:#FFF; width:1011px; margin:0 auto}
.footer table { width:670px; margin: 0 auto;}
.nav3 ul { width:632px; margin:0 auto; height:25px;}
.footer ul li { float:left;}
.footer ul li a { color:#FFF; text-decoration:none;}
.footer ul li a:hover { color:#02fd25; text-decoration:none;}
.copyright { width: auto; text-align:center; }

.banner{position:relative;}
.bigBanner{width:976px;height:260px; overflow:hidden; }
.smallBanner {position:absolute; top:200px; right:0px;}
.smallBanner li{ float:left; padding-right:10px; filter:alpha(opacity=50);-moz-opacity:0.5;opacity: 0.5;}
.smallBanner img{ border:1px #FFF solid}
.smallBannerSelect img{border:2px #FFF solid}
.right3 { padding-top:10px;}

li.outppt{filter:alpha(opacity=50);-moz-opacity:0.5;opacity: 0.5; }
li.overppt{filter:alpha(opacity=100);-moz-opacity:1;opacity:1; }

.png{ behavior: expression((this.runtimeStyle.behavior="none")&&(this.pngSet?this.pngSet=true:(this.nodeName == "IMG" && this.src.toLowerCase().indexOf('.png')>-1?(this.runtimeStyle.backgroundImage = "none", this.runtimeStyle.filter = "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='" + this.src + "', sizingMethod='image')", this.src = "../images/1.gif"):(this.origBg = this.origBg? this.origBg :this.currentStyle.backgroundImage.toString().replace('url("','').replace('")',''), this.runtimeStyle.filter = "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='" + this.origBg + "', sizingMethod='crop')", this.runtimeStyle.backgroundImage = "none")),this.pngSet=true) ); } 